Laser Acne Treatment Tip #1
Before getting laser acne treatment, make sure that your dermatologist has determined the cause of your acne. There are different kinds of laser acne treatments and usually each one of them treats only one factor. Most doctors find that utilizing different forms of laser treatments work best for most of their clients as they simultaneously treat all factors.

Laser Acne Treatment Tip #4
Listen to your doctor. All laser acne treatments require a great measure of post-operative treatment and you’ll need to follow that if you’d like them to heal quickly. Aside from healing quickly, taking note of the things you can do and are not supposed to do helps in preventing you from doing more damage to yourself.
